This change adds APIs support for implementing UI tests. Such tests do not rely on internal application structure and can span across application boundaries. UI automation APIs are encapsulated in the UiAutomation object that is provided by an Instrumentation object. It is initialized by the system and can be used for both introspecting the screen and performing interactions simulating a user. UI test are normal instrumentation tests and are executed on the device. UiAutomation uses the accessibility APIs to introspect the screen and a special delegate object to perform privileged operations such as injecting input events. Since instrumentation tests are invoked by a shell command, the shell program launching the tests creates a delegate object and passes it as an argument to started instrumentation. This delegate allows the APK that runs the tests to access some privileged operations protected by a signature level permissions which are explicitly granted to the shell user. The UiAutomation object also supports running tests in the legacy way where the tests are run as a Java shell program. This enables existing UiAutomator tests to keep working while the new ones should be implemented using the new APIs. The UiAutomation object exposes lower level APIs which allow simulation of arbitrary user interactions and writing complete UI test cases. Clients, such as UiAutomator, are encouraged to implement higher- level APIs which minimize development effort and can be used as a helper library by the test developer. The benefit of this change is decoupling UiAutomator from the system since the former was calling hidden APIs which required that it is bundled in the system image. This prevented UiAutomator from being evolved separately from the system. Also UiAutomator was creating additional API surface in the system image. Another benefit of the new design is that now test cases have access to a context and can use public platform APIs in addition to the UiAutomator ones. Further, third-parties can develop their own higher level test APIs on top of the lower level ones exposes by UiAutomation. bug:8028258 Also this change adds the fully qualified resource name of the view's id in the emitted AccessibilityNodeInfo if a special flag is set while configuring the accessibility service. Also added is API for looking up node infos by this id. The id resource name is relatively more stable compared to the generaed id number which may change from one build to another.
